Saturday outings

On Saturday, we decided to drive to Lebanon, PA to get homemade soft pretzels from Shuey's. It was a bit of a drive (because there are NO straight roads in PA), but worth it. The pretzels were very good. Their main business is hard pretzels (which are also very good), and they only make soft pretzels on Saturdays. We got two large pretzels and a couple smaller ones. From Lebanon, we headed over to Hershey to visit Chocolate World. They have a fun ride that takes you through the manufacturing process of chocolate. It was crazy busy at Chocolate World! We asked one of the workers as we were standing in line for the ride how many people had been there on Friday. He said 17,000! Luckily, the line moved quickly, and we were soon on the ride.
